If you are looking at a repack of , you are looking at a digital artifact of one of the most controversial moments in PC gaming history. This specific build represents the bridge between the modern "broken" version of the game and the classic experience everyone actually wants.
No discussion of Build 459558 is complete without addressing the elephant in the room. Build 459558 was compiled after the "Hot Coffee" scandal, but it is based on the v1.0 codebase. The assets (the animation scripts) are still present in the executable and game files. However, unlike the original October 2004 disc, the trigger to access the mini-game is disabled.
